About The Role

We're seeking a sharp, pragmatic, and globally minded Senior Employment Counsel with deep UK employment law expertise to join our growing legal team. Based in our London office and reporting to our Associate General Counsel, Employment in San Francisco, this role will serve as the primary employment law advisor for our UK and EMEA operations while also supporting employment matters across our global footprint.

What You’ll Do

  • Serve as the go‑to employment counsel for our UK and EMEA teams, advising on the full range of employment issues including hiring, performance management, terminations, compensation, investigations, and employee relations.
  • Partner with the People team and business leaders to support compliant, scalable employee lifecycle practices across the region.
  • Conduct and oversee internal workplace investigations.
  • Collaborate on and lead employment‑related litigation and pre‑litigation matters.
  • Develop and scale employment processes through policies, training, templates, and tooling tailored to UK and EMEA requirements.
  • Monitor legal and regulatory developments across EMEA jurisdictions and assess their business impact.
  • Support cross‑border employment issues, including remote work, international expansion, and mobility.
  • Work closely with employment counsel colleagues in other regions to ensure consistency and share best practices across the global legal team.

Who You Are

  • 5–11 years’ post‑qualification experience focused primarily on UK employment law, with a mix of in‑house and law firm experience strongly preferred.
  • Qualified solicitor in England and Wales; additional qualifications or experience in other EMEA jurisdictions a plus.
  • Deep subject‑matter expertise in UK employment law, with exposure to employment laws across EMEA.
  • Proven ability to lead or advise on sensitive employee relations matters and investigations.
  • A clear, concise communicator who can synthesize issues and provide actionable guidance quickly, with comfort operating across time zones.
  • Skilled at working independently and navigating ambiguity in a high‑growth, global business.
  • Strong judgment, discretion, and a collaborative approach.
  • Fluent in English; additional European languages are a plus.
